Converti diapositive PPT PowerPoint in SVG in Python

I file PowerPoint PPT o PPTX vengono spesso convertiti in altri formati per scopi diversi. Questo potrebbe essere utile quando si stampano le diapositive, si crea una presentazione o un visualizzatore di PowerPoint, ecc. Tra gli altri formati, SVG è un popolare formato di immagine vettoriale utilizzato per rappresentare le diapositive PPT. Di conseguenza, in questo articolo imparerai come convertire le diapositive PPT di PowerPoint in immagini SVG in Python.

Libreria Python per convertire diapositive PowerPoint in SVG

Aspose.Slides for Python è una straordinaria libreria che fornisce un sacco di funzionalità per creare e manipolare presentazioni PowerPoint. Puoi creare presentazioni semplici o complesse da zero senza problemi. Inoltre, la libreria ti consente di convertire file PPT, PPTX e ODP in altri formati popolari. Useremo questa libreria per convertire le nostre presentazioni PPT/PPTX in immagini SVG. Puoi installarlo da PyPI usando il seguente comando pip.

> pip install aspose.slides

Converti diapositive PPT PowerPoint in SVG in Python

Per convertire una presentazione PowerPoint in immagini SVG, dovrai attraversare le diapositive. Dopo aver effettuato l’accesso a una diapositiva, puoi salvarla facilmente come immagine SVG. Vediamo quindi come convertire le diapositive in un file PPT/PPTX in immagini SVG in Python.

  • Carica il file PPT/PPTX utilizzando la classe Presentation.
  • Scorri le diapositive utilizzando la raccolta Presentation.slides.
  • Converti ogni diapositiva in SVG usando il metodo Slide.writeassvg().

L’esempio di codice seguente mostra come convertire le diapositive in un file PPTX in immagini SVG in Python.

import aspose.slides as slides

# Load the presentation
with slides.Presentation("presentation.pptx") as presentation:

    # Loop through the slides
    for slide in presentation.slides:

        # Export slides to SVG format
        with open("presentation_slide_{0}.svg".format(str(slide.slide_number)), "wb") as file:
            slide.write_as_svg(file)

Lo screenshot seguente mostra una diapositiva PPT dopo la conversione in un’immagine SVG.

Converti diapositive PPT PowerPoint in SVG in Python

Ottieni una licenza gratuita

Puoi ottenere una licenza temporanea gratuita per provare Aspose.Slides per Python senza limitazioni di valutazione.

Conclusione

La conversione da PowerPoint PPT/PPTX a SVG è utile in vari casi, ad esempio per presentazioni, rendering/stampa di diapositive di alta qualità, ecc. In questo articolo, hai imparato come convertire PowerPoint PPT o PPTX in SVG in Python. Puoi installare facilmente Aspose.Slides per Python e integrare la conversione da PowerPoint a SVG nelle tue applicazioni Python. Inoltre, puoi esplorare di più su Aspose.Slides per Python usando documentazione. Inoltre, puoi farci sapere delle tue domande tramite il nostro forum.

Guarda anche